Seven Layer Salad Squares

2 [8 oz] pkgs refrigerated crescent dinner rolls
8 oz cream cheese softened
1/2 cup salad dressing
1 clove garlic minced
6 slices bacon crisply cooked, drained and crumbled divided
1 cup frozen peas thawed, divided
3 plum tomatoes sliced
2 cups thinly sliced lettuce
1/2 cup shredded Cheddar cheese
1/2 cup coarsely chopped red onion

Preheat oven to 375o
Unroll one pkg dough across one end of a bar pan
with longest sides of dough across width of pan
Repeat with remaining pkg of dough filling pan
Using rolling pin or your fingers seal seams and press up sides to form
crust
Bake 12-15 min until golden brown
Remove from oven to cooling rack, cool completely
Beat cream cheese, salad dressing and garlic until smooth
Add half the bacon, half the peas, mix well
Spread cream cheese mixture over crust
Arrange sliced tomatoes over cream cheese mixture
Sprinkle remaining bacon, remaining peas, lettuce, Cheddar cheese and
onion over tomatoes
Cut into squares and serve.
